Pancake Toppings
-
Apple pie filling and a dollop of whipped topping. If the pie filling is not seasoned, add some cinnamon as well.
-
Bananas with whipped topping or vanilla yogurt.
-
Apple slices with maple syrup.
-
Strawberry syrup with sliced strawberries.
-
Whipped topping with shaved chocolate.
-
A tablespoon or two of chocolate syrup with banana or strawberry slices.
-
Pineapple syrup with cherries. Choose fresh cherries.
-
Raspberry or maple syrup and raspberries.
-
Blackberries and vanilla yogurt.
-
Plain yogurt and sweet apple slices topped with cinnamon.

Serving Suggestions
-
Unless you are using fruit as a topping choice, you will want to add some as a side dish to this meal. Try chunks of honey dew and cantaloupe with a dollop or two of vanilla yogurt.
-
Pork or beef products go well with pancakes and fruit.
